Claims Analysis
Types of Claims
The patent encompasses a series of claims, likely structured as:
- Independent Claims: Broadly define the invention—e.g., a novel compound or a unique pharmaceutical composition.
- Dependent Claims: Narrow the scope, specify particular embodiments, formulations, methods of use, dosages, or administration routes.
The clarity and breadth of independent claims determine the strength of the patent’s enforceability.
Scope of the Claims
Chemical Compound Claims
If DK3106463 pertains to a new chemical entity, the claims likely articulate the molecular structure with specific functional groups. Broad claims may cover a class of compounds (Markush groups), enabling patent protection over a family of related molecules. Narrower claims typically specify particular derivatives or salts.
Method of Use Claims
These claims focus on therapeutic applications, such as treatment of specific diseases (e.g., oncology, neurodegenerative disorders), which extend the patent’s enforceability to method-based protections.
Formulation and Delivery Claims
If the patent addresses formulations or delivery methods (e.g., sustained release, nanoparticle encapsulation), it broadens the scope, protecting specific innovations in drug delivery.
Legal Scope and Enforcement
The breadth of independent claims determines the potential for generic challenges. Overly broad claims risk invalidation if prior art exists; narrowly tailored claims offer stronger enforceability but narrower commercial protection.
Given Denmark’s adherence to European patent practices, the claims are likely consistent with EPO standards, emphasizing novelty, inventive step, and industrial applicability.
